Mbia fined over Barton tweet



QPR have fined midfielder Stephane Mbia following comments made on his Twitter account hinting that he may be keen to rejoin Marseille.



Mbia left the French club in August to move to Loftus Road in a deal that saw Joey Barton head in the opposite direction on a season-long loan deal.



The 26-year-old spent three years at Marseille and tweeted at Barton on Monday: "Do you want to rechange your seat with me?"



The tweet prompted an investigation by QPR officials and Ian Taylor, the club's head of media and communications, has revealed that disciplinary action has been taken against Mbia.



"The club has concluded its investigation following a series of tweets which appeared on Stephane Mbia's official Twitter account," tweeted Taylor.



"Stephane has stressed to the club that he is not responsible for the tweets.



"However, the club is of the view that every player that has a Twitter account is ultimately responsible for what appears on it



"As a result, Stephane has been fined and warned in relation to his future conduct. The club will be making no further comment."
